Frankston Crime Investigation Unit detectives have released CCTV footage following the theft of a backpack from a Frankston hotel last month. Investigators believe the unknown woman attended the smoking area of the hotel about 4.45pm on 10 October. She waited until the owner stepped away from the bag before covering it in her hooded top and fleeing. The bag contained the man’s wallet and other personal items. Transit Crime Investigation Unit detectives have arrested a man after an 87-year-old woman was allegedly sexually assaulted at Aspendale Railway Station on 22 September. A 40 year old Frankston man was arrested yesterday (7 November) morning and subsequently charged with sexual assault. He has been bailed to appear at the Melbourne Magistrates Court on 15 December. A STOLEN ute which evaded police on Peninsula Link was later seen in a Seaford service station with a rifle in the tray, early morning Tuesday 31 October. Acting Senior Sergeant Glenn Michie, of Frankston police, said police spotted the yellow Ford ute with false number plates at 12.05am. They ordered the driver to pull over but he sped away and the chase was abandoned. OFFENDERS shattered the glass front doors of three businesses causing more damage than the thefts would warrant, overnight 2-3 November. A home-renovation business in Chifley Drive, Mentone, was broken into overnight Thursday 2 November by offenders who smashed their way into the office. Nothing was taken. Offenders used a fire hydrant bollard to smash the glass front door of a motor repairer in Chesterville Rd, Moorabbin, 2am, Friday 3 November. They ran off when the alarm sounded.
